Our Lesson Horses
Though we use almost all of our horses in lessons, there are a few that are instrumental to our lesson program. We plan on keeping these horses, but if the right person comes along, we may consider selling!

Trac is a 17 year old Quarter Horse mare. She is by far one of the best horses on the property. Whether you are interested in English, Western, trail riding, cows, driving, ground training, jumping, or showing you will at some time meet Trac. She is great for beginners to advanced, kids to adults.
Level: Beginner/ Intermediate

Twinkie is our resident Miniature horse. For obvious reasons, only kids can ride him, but he is a great horse to have on the property. He is used in girl scouts and summer camps to explain the anatomy of a horse. Triangle H Farm wouldn't be the same without the friendly whinny of Twinkie.
Level: Beginner
